JavaScript 数组(Array) 方法

JavaScript array.pop()方法从给定数组中移除最后一个元素并返回该元素。此方法更改原始数组的长度。

语法

pop() 方法由以下语法表示:

array.pop()

返回

给定数组的最后一个元素。

方法示例

让我们看一些 pop() 方法的例子。

示例1

在这里,我们将从给定的数组中弹出一个元素。

<script>
var arr=["AngularJS","Node.js","JQuery"];
document.writeln("Orginal array: "+arr+"<br>");
document.writeln("Extracted element: "+arr.pop()+"<br>");
document.writeln("Remaining elements: "+ arr);
</script>

输出:

Orginal array: AngularJS,Node.js,JQuery
Extracted element: JQuery
Remaining elements: AngulaJS,Node.js

示例 2

在本例中,我们将从给定数组中弹出所有元素。

<script>
var arr=["AngulaJS","Node.js","JQuery"];
var len=arr.length;

for(var x=1;x<=len;x++)
  {
document.writeln("Extracted element: "+arr.pop()+"<br>");
  }
</script>

输出:

Extracted element: JQuery
Extracted element: Node.js
Extracted element: AngulaJS